The amount of time for which undo is retained for the Oracle Database for the current undo tablespace can be obtained by querying the TUNEDUNDORETENTION column of the V$UNDOSTAT dynamic performance view.
To change the size of the undo tablespace in Oracle, you can either resize an existing datafile or add a new datafile to the tablespace. -- Resizing datafile. SQL ALTER DATABASE DATAFILE /opt/oracle/oradata/XE/XEPDB1/undotbs01.
If an active transaction requires undo space and the undo tablespace does not have available space, then the system starts reusing unexpired undo space. This action can potentially cause some queries to fail with the snapshot too old message.
Implicit undo tablespaces are created in the default undo directory and they are not permitted to be dropped. But they can be made inactive with; ALTER UNDO TABLESPACE `innodbundo001` SET INACTIVE; Both implicit undo tablespaces will be made active at bootstrap and remain active until they are SET INACTIVE.
The UNDO tablespace works as follows: * The UNDO records are not deleted when they are expired. They stay and are overwritten only when a new UNDO record needs to be written and there is no free space. Thus, it is normal for UNDOTBS1 to appear at 99% full.
Your production database has semiannual or annual purging programs which generate huge redo. Due to this requirement, your undo tablespace grows rapidly and occupies most of the space on file system. The purging process is run only few times a year.
Thus the only solution to accomplish the goal are as follows : Create a new undo tablespace(The following command will create the Bigfile tablespace with the size of 100MB initially) : Set the new tablespace as the undo tablespace to be used: Once the above step is done then drop the old undo tablespace:
An auto-extending undo tablespace named UNDOTBS1 is automatically created when you create the database with Database Configuration Assistant (DBCA). You can also create an undo tablespace explicitly. The methods of creating an undo tablespace are explained in Creating an Undo Tablespace.
